In what form is DNA typically represented when discussing its sequence?

a) As a sequence of nucleotides
b) In the double-helix shape of the condensed chromosome
c) As a pattern of phosphates and sugars
d) In the ratio of adenine to thymine

Final answer:

DNA is typically represented as a sequence of nucleotides, which are the building blocks of genetic information encoded in the DNA sequence.

Step-by-step explanation:

When discussing its sequence, DNA is typically represented as a sequence of nucleotides. Each nucleotide is composed of three parts: a sugar (deoxyribose), a phosphate group, and a nitrogen-containing base (adenine, guanine, cytosine, or thymine), and the sequence of these bases along the DNA strand encodes genetic information. The double-helix structure of DNA consists of two polynucleotide chains that are complementary and antiparallel, meaning that they run in opposite directions. During the process of DNA replication, each daughter cell receives a copy of the DNA, ensuring that the genetic information is faithfully transmitted.
